Forget the "real Italian Folk music" and check this: Cornice Inferiore It has the lyrics and a selection of midi files of nearly every "Neopolitan" tune that there is--these are the tunes that you hear at Italian Weddings, in the soundtracks of movies, and in Italian restaurants--it is the music that everybody everywhere knows--the problem with "authentic" Italian folk music is that it is *very* regional, and will only be familiar to folks from the specific area that the music is from(at least if you're lucky)--

I remember once going to a lot oftrouble finding recordings of songs collected in the region where my family came from, only to find that, not only were they unfamiliar to my grandmother, but they weren't even in the same dialect that they spoke--

The nice thing about Neopolitan tunes is that they have great melodies, so that singing is optional--a guitar and one or more melody instrument will be all you need--(no one ever understands the lyrics anyway, because they are mostly in dialect)
